Questions people actually ask about Playa Panamá.
Is Playa Panamá safe for swimming with children?
Yes, Playa Panamá is excellent for families with children. The beach sits within a protected bay in the Gulf of Papagayo, creating naturally calm waters with minimal waves and currents. The gentle slope and long stretch of sand allow for safe wading and swimming. Lifeguards are not typically present, so parental supervision is essential. The calm conditions make it one of the safest swimming beaches on the Papagayo Peninsula, particularly compared to more exposed Pacific beaches in the region.
What is the best time of year to visit Playa Panamá?
Playa Panamá enjoys favorable conditions year-round, though the dry season from December through April offers the most reliable sunshine and calm seas. The green season from May to November brings occasional afternoon showers but fewer crowds and lower accommodation rates. Water temperatures remain warm throughout the year. Since the beach sits in a protected bay, it remains swimmable even during windier months when other Pacific beaches experience rougher conditions. Any time is suitable depending on your preferences for weather versus crowds.
